H935 BYF is a 2003 Toyota Soarer in White with a 2,490c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2003 Toyota Soarer models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.9% with a typical mileage of 117,900 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Toyota Soarer f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 522 recorded failures. If you're considering buying H935 BYF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ota Soarer typically stays on UK roads for around 35 years. At 23 years old, this Toyota Soarer is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
